Start your trip by arriving in Shimla, the capital city of Himachal Pradesh. In the morning, explore the Mall Road, a bustling shopping street with numerous shops and cafes. Enjoy the panoramic views of the surrounding mountains from Scandal Point. In the afternoon, visit the Viceregal Lodge, a heritage building with beautiful architecture and gardens. As the evening sets in, experience the vibrant nightlife of Shimla by visiting popular bars and clubs.
Leave Shimla in the morning and travel to Manali, a picturesque hill station. Start your day by visiting the Hadimba Devi Temple, a unique wooden temple dedicated to the goddess Hadimba. Enjoy adventurous activities like paragliding and river rafting in the afternoon. In the evening, explore the vibrant streets of Old Manali and indulge in the local cuisine and nightlife.
Embark on a day trip to Kasol, a small village known for its scenic beauty and hippie culture. In the morning, explore the charming streets of Kasol and visit the Manikaran Sahib Gurudwara, a famous Sikh pilgrimage site. Enjoy trekking in the beautiful Parvati Valley in the afternoon. In the evening, unwind at the riverside cafes and soak in the peaceful surroundings.
Travel to Dharamshala, a spiritual town famous for its Tibetan culture. Begin your day by visiting the Tsuglagkhang Complex, the Dalai Lama's residence and a major Buddhist pilgrimage site. Explore the colorful markets of McLeod Ganj in the afternoon, known for its vibrant Tibetan handicrafts. In the evening, attend a traditional Tibetan cultural performance and enjoy a delicious Tibetan dinner.
Head to Dalhousie, a charming hill station with colonial architecture. Start your day by visiting the St. John's Church, known for its beautiful stained glass windows. Enjoy a leisurely walk through the scenic Khajjiar, often referred to as the "Mini Switzerland of India," in the afternoon. Witness a mesmerizing sunset at Dainkund Peak in the evening.
Conclude your bachelor party adventure with a visit to Chandigarh, the well-planned city. Spend the morning exploring the Rock Garden, a unique sculpture garden made of recycled materials. Visit the Sukhna Lake in the afternoon and indulge in boating activities. In the evening, shop for souvenirs at Sector 17 Plaza and enjoy a farewell dinner.
If you're looking for off the beaten path attractions and places loved by locals, be sure to explore the Tirthan Valley near Manali. This serene valley offers opportunities for trout fishing, hiking, and camping. You can also visit the hot springs in Manikaran and rejuvenate in the natural sulfur waters. Additionally, in Dharamshala, don't miss the Norbulingka Institute, which showcases Tibetan art and culture.
